[Releasing] Meeting minutes from Qt Release Team meeting 2.6.2020
jani.heikkinen at qt.io
Tue Jun 2 16:32:38 CEST 2020
Meeting minutes from Qt Release Team meeting Tue 2nd June 2020
Qt 5.15 status:
- 5.15.0 released Tue 26th May
- 5.15.1 planned to be released on August
- Release preparations started
* Soft branching from '5.12' to '5.12.9' should start today
* Final downmerge from '5.12' to '5.12.9' will happen at the end of this week
- Release target Tue 16th June
* Initial changes files will be created soon, please finalize those immediately when available to avoid delay to the release
* release blocker list here: https://bugreports.qt.io/issues/?filter=22349 . Please make sure all blockers are visible in the list immediately.
Next meeting Tue 4.8.2020 16:00 CET
irc log below:
[17:00:40] <jaheikki3> akseli: iieklund: thiago: lars: frkleint: vladimir-m: ankokko: mapaaso:carewolf: fregl: ablasche: ping
[17:00:48] <frkleint> jaheikki3: pong
[17:01:23] <akseli> jaheikki3: pong
[17:02:36] <jaheikki3> Time to start qt release team meeting
[17:02:45] <jaheikki3> On agenda today:
[17:02:56] <carewolf> pong
[17:03:05] <jaheikki3> Qt 5.15 status
[17:03:13] <jaheikki3> Qt 5.12 status
[17:03:21] <jaheikki3> Any additional items to the agenda?
[17:03:40] <carewolf> is the date of 5.15.1 set in stone? It seems odd not to have in June
[17:04:57] <carewolf> I guess that could fall under 5.15 status though
[17:05:19] <jaheikki3> Yeah, that will be part of Qt 5.15.0 statua
[17:05:33] <jaheikki3> So let's start from Qt 5.15.0 status
[17:05:39] <jaheikki3> It will be short :D
[17:05:45] <jaheikki3> Qt 5.15.0 released
[17:05:55] <jaheikki3> ~ a week ago
[17:05:55] <carewolf> yay!
[17:06:03] <jaheikki3> Nothing alarmin so far
[17:06:17] <jaheikki3> Target is to release Qt 5.15.1 in August
[17:07:28] <jaheikki3> I understand that it would be good to be able to get it out before summer holidays but after discusions with others & mgmt we have agreed August should be ok
[17:08:08] <jaheikki3> But that's pretty much all about Qt 5.15 status at the moment. Any comments or questions?
[17:08:08] <carewolf> ok, we just always have had a x.1 release in June when we released in May.
[17:08:35] <frkleint> but it would be good to have it stabilized well before 6.0,. that is, at 5.15.2, 3
[17:08:49] <frkleint> due to the changed licensing
[17:09:55] <carewolf> that too
[17:11:15] <jaheikki3> Yeah. It is just that we want to avoid unnecessary hassle & delays to holiday plans and that's why August is much better
[17:11:27] <jaheikki3> As I wrote that is OK to mgmt as well
[17:12:31] <jaheikki3> And it seems 5.15.0 is actually pretty good one so 5.15.1 in august should be enough. And then there is time to do additional patch releases before Qt6.0.0
[17:13:30] <carewolf> I would have preferred an earlier release, so we could fix a few regression in qtwebengine (pdf viewer broken for instance) before updating chromium in 5.15.2 :/
[17:13:42] <carewolf> oh well
[17:16:40] <jaheikki3> I understand. But let's try that plan now. We will start release preparations at the end of July so we should be able to get the release out ~ Mid August.
[17:17:46] <jaheikki3> Ok, then Qt 5.12 status
[17:18:21] <jaheikki3> We have agreet to (try) to release Qt 5.12.9 before summer holidays
[17:18:42] <jaheikki3> That should be quite easy release so even there isn't that much time left that should be doable
[17:18:56] <jaheikki3> So release preparations is already started
[17:19:08] <frkleint> does it have any changes at all...
[17:19:40] <jaheikki3> actually there is ~90 changes
[17:19:57] <frkleint> oho
[17:20:01] <carewolf> we will be adding around 40 more for webengine
[17:20:08] <jaheikki3> But of course ~ 40 of those are version bumbs etc so ~40-50 real ones
[17:20:49] <jaheikki3> Soft branching from '5.12' to '5.12.9' should start today
[17:21:33] <jaheikki3> And let's keep soft branching period short & do the final downmerge from '5.12' to '5.12.9' at the end of this week
[17:21:55] <jaheikki3> And release target is Tue 16th June
[17:22:07] <jaheikki3> Initial changes files will be created soon, please finalize those immediately when available to avoid delay to the release
[17:22:31] <jaheikki3> And make sure all release blockers are visible in blocker list, see https://bugreports.qt.io/issues/?filter=22349
[17:22:54] <jaheikki3> But that's all about 5.12 status now, any other comments or questions?
[17:25:49] <jaheikki3> Ok, it was all at this time.
[17:25:53] <jaheikki3> I think there isn't that much releasing related stuff to handle before summer vacatios so I let's have next meeting at the beginning of August
[17:26:29] <akseli> +1
[17:26:55] <jaheikki3> Thanks for participation, bye!
[17:28:17] <frkleint> bye
More information about the Releasing